Yala is Sri Lanka’s most celebrated wildlife reserve and a rewarding journey for guests who are passionate about seeing animals in their natural environment. Although further from Talpe, it is especially sought after by those hoping to spot leopards, as Yala is believed to have the highest leopard population density in the world. Guided safaris take you across open plains, rock formations, lagoons, and forest landscapes where elephants, crocodiles, deer, birds, and other wildlife move freely. The experience blends excitement, patience, and genuine connection to nature. For adventurous travellers, Yala offers a powerful and unforgettable encounter with the wild.
